Hi Justin, welcome to the AnkiHub Community!

The issue you’re experiencing with unsuspending cards is likely related to how Anki handles daily limits. While you’ve set your daily new card limit to 250, there are a few possible explanations for why only 10 of the 90 cards are showing up:

  1. Daily limits apply differently across subdecks: In Anki’s V3 scheduler (the most recent), each deck and subdeck has its own limit. If you’re studying a parent deck that contains the subdeck you unsuspended, the subdeck might have a lower new card limit than the parent deck.

  2. Review limits affecting new cards: By default, new cards are capped by your review limit. If you have a backlog of reviews, this could be limiting the number of new cards that appear. This setting can be changed in deck options.

  3. Siblings being buried: If you have the “bury related new cards” option enabled in your deck options, Anki will automatically hide sibling cards (cards from the same note) until the next day.

To fix this issue, try the following:

  1. Check the specific deck options for the subdeck:

    • Right-click on the deck in the deck list
    • Select “Options”
    • Look at the “New cards/day” setting for that specific subdeck
    • Also check if “New Cards Ignore Review Limit” is enabled
  2. Verify that the cards are actually unsuspended:

    • In the browser, make sure you’re viewing “Cards” and not “Notes” mode
    • Look for the suspended indicator (a small circle with a line through it)
  3. Check if you have a limit on the maximum number of reviews per day that might be affecting your new cards.
